Algebra Basics: The Building Blocks
Algebra is often seen as the gateway to higher mathematics, and grade 7 is when you start laying down those essential building blocks. You'll learn about variables (like x and y) and how they represent unknown quantities. We'll explore equations and inequalities, which are fundamental tools for solving real-world problems. Think of algebra as a language that helps us describe relationships between numbers in a concise and powerful way.
The Number System: Fractions, Decimals, and More
The number system is the backbone of mathematics, and grade 7 delves deeper into its intricacies. You'll expand your understanding of fractions and decimals, learning how to perform operations like addition, subtraction, multiplication, and division with these numbers. Additionally, you'll explore rational numbers, which include both fractions and terminating decimals. Understanding the number system is crucial for developing a solid grasp of more complex mathematical concepts.
Geometry Overview: Shapes, Angles, and Transformations
Geometry is all about shapes, sizes, positions, and properties of space. In grade 7, you'll dive into the fascinating world of geometry, exploring different types of angles (acute, obtuse, right), triangles, quadrilaterals, and circles. You'll also learn about transformations, such as translations (slides), reflections (flips), and rotations (turns). These concepts not only enhance your spatial reasoning skills but also help you understand the beauty and symmetry found in nature and art.
Problem Solving Strategies: Tools for Success
One of the most valuable skills you'll develop in grade 7 is problem-solving. This involves breaking down complex problems into smaller, manageable parts and applying logical thinking to find solutions. Techniques like working backward, drawing diagrams, and using patterns are invaluable. By mastering these strategies, you'll not only excel in math but also gain skills that are useful in everyday life.
Math in Everyday Life: Real-World Applications
Mathematics is not just about solving abstract problems; it has numerous practical applications in everyday life. For instance, understanding percentages can help you calculate discounts while shopping. Ratios and proportions are essential when cooking or mixing ingredients. Geometry plays a role in designing buildings and creating artwork. By connecting math to real-life situations, you can see its relevance and importance beyond the classroom.
Study Tips and Resources: Maximizing Your Learning Potential
To excel in grade 7 math, it's important to have a structured approach to studying. Here are some tips:
- Practice regularly: Consistency is key in mathematics. Set aside dedicated time each day to review concepts and solve problems.
- Seek help when needed: Don't hesitate to ask your teacher or classmates for assistance. Online resources like Khan Academy (https://www.khanacademy.org/math/pre-algebra) and Mathway (https://www.mathway.com/) can also be incredibly helpful.
- Join study groups: Collaborating with peers can provide new perspectives and insights.
